Kenneth Elsie

Kenneth F. Elsie
Born: 1921
Primary Position: Third base
All Position(s) Played: OF, SS
Bats: Left
Throws: Right
Height: 5'8"
Weight: 155
Career: 1940-1942

Kenneth Elsie compiled a career batting average of .297 with 19 home runs and 0 RBI in his 259-game career with the Olean Oilers, Niagara Falls Rainbows/Jamestown Falcons, Rome Colonels, London Pirates and Hornell Pirates. He began playing during the 1940 season and last took the field during the 1942 campaign.
